Output 3d5c756eb5a3d3a515465eaae95fbb5c2edfeb5be6c2c20c6135852f0cade73b:1

value
40377086
script pubkey
OP_0 OP_PUSHBYTES_20 52527235388ce88c68d2c40b76731c30b89f5242
address
bc1q2ff8ydfc3n5gc6xjcs9hvucuxzuf75jzk675lz
transaction
3d5c756eb5a3d3a515465eaae95fbb5c2edfeb5be6c2c20c6135852f0cade73b
confirmations
4129
spent
true